Interest Rates and the Stock Market: A 2026 Prognosis

Lower interest rates, akin to a benevolent benefactor, diminish the burden of debt, thereby inflating corporate profits. They similarly enable companies to procure additional funds to stoke the fires of growth, promising tantalizing returns for the ever-hopeful investor. However, in the shadowy corridors of power, the U.S. Federal Reserve grapples with the unsightly specter of rising unemployment, a condition that suggests the economy may soon face an existential crisis. Wall Street, ever the oracle, anticipates further interest rate reductions in this new year of 2026.

‘Stranger Things’ Fans Stunned to Discover One Character Was Played by Twins

Many viewers were surprised to learn that the character Holly was actually played by twin actresses. Fans on TikTok reacted with shock, with comments like “There are two?” and “Wait, does that mean the Holly from Stranger Things has a twin?” Some people even admitted they hadn’t realized it at all, saying, “I never even noticed!”

Is Cyrene HSR Right for You? Here’s a Full Breakdown of Her Kit!

Cyrene is a new character in Honkai Star Rail with a distinct playstyle. She focuses on steady, strategic gameplay and providing consistent value over time, rather than relying on quick bursts of power.
